Starkey, Brigid
Item prices starting from
£ 3.69
Starkey, Brigid; Boyer, Mark A.; Wilkenfeld, Jonathan
Item prices starting from
£ 4.68
Also find
UsedStarkey, Brigid; Boyer, Mark A.; Wilkenfeld, Jonathan
Item prices starting from
£ 9.64
Also find
UsedStarkey, Brigid
Item prices starting from
£ 21.82